Two Days in Vadodara: Exploring the Cultural Capital of Gujarat

Saturday, November 4, 2023

Morning: Baroda Museum and Picture Gallery

Start your day by visiting the Baroda Museum and Picture Gallery, located in the heart of Vadodara. This museum houses a vast collection of art, sculptures, archaeological artifacts, and natural history exhibits. Explore the rich history and culture of Gujarat as you wander through the museum's halls. Don't miss the collection of Mughal miniatures and the impressive Egyptian mummy. Estimated cost: INR 50 per person. Estimated time spent: 2 hours.

Afternoon: Laxmi Vilas Palace

After a delightful morning at the museum, make your way to the Laxmi Vilas Palace, one of the largest private residences in the world and a stunning architectural masterpiece. Explore the opulent interiors, extravagant artwork, and beautiful gardens. Take a leisurely stroll in the well-maintained palace grounds, and admire the fusion of Indian and European architectural styles. Estimated cost: INR 200 per person. Estimated time spent: 2-3 hours.

Evening: Sayaji Gardens and Vadodara Street Food

In the evening, head to Sayaji Gardens, a peaceful oasis in the heart of the city. Take a relaxing walk amidst lush greenery, flowering plants, and tranquil lakes. Enjoy the pleasant weather under the shade of the trees and experience the local vibe. Be sure to try some mouthwatering Vadodara street food like sev usal, vada pav, and pav bhaji from the nearby food stalls. Estimated cost: INR 100 per person. Estimated time spent: 2 hours.

Sunday, November 5, 2023

Morning: Champaner-Pavagadh Archaeological Park

Embark on an excursion to the Champaner-Pavagadh Archaeological Park, a UNESCO World Heritage Site located about 50 kilometers from Vadodara. Explore the ancient ruins, forts, temples, and mosques nestled in the lush foothills of Pavagadh. Visit the iconic Kalika Mata Temple, which requires a short cable car ride to reach the hilltop. Experience the serenity and historical significance of this unique archaeological site. Estimated cost (including transportation): INR 500 per person. Estimated time spent: 4-5 hours.

Afternoon: Old City Walk and Mandvi Gate

After returning from Champaner-Pavagadh, take a leisurely walk through the narrow lanes of the old city, known for its vibrant heritage houses, traditional markets, and lively atmosphere. Explore the Mandvi Gate, a historic entrance to the walled city, and witness the fusion of Hindu and Islamic architecture. Immerse yourself in the local culture, interact with artisans, and shop for traditional handicrafts and textiles. Estimated cost: INR 50 per person. Estimated time spent: 2-3 hours.

Evening: Kirti Mandir and Vadodara Street Market

To end your Vadodara trip on a high note, visit Kirti Mandir, the iconic memorial dedicated to Mahatma Gandhi and the Kasturba Gandhi family. Explore the exhibits portraying Gandhi's remarkable life and legacy. In the nearby Vadodara Street Market, indulge in some last-minute shopping for traditional Gujarati textiles, jewelry, handicrafts, and spices. Savor the bustling atmosphere and bid farewell to this culturally rich city. Estimated cost: INR 100 per person. Estimated time spent: 2 hours.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Vadodara, don't forget to check out Narmada Canal, a serene and picturesque place popular among locals for evening walks and bird-watching. Another hidden gem is EME Temple, a unique temple dedicated to Lord Dakshinamurthy, known for its striking architecture and tranquil ambiance. For a local culinary experience, head to Mandap Restaurant and enjoy traditional Gujarati thali, a lavish spread of vegetarian delicacies. These off-the-beaten-path attractions and local favorites offer a glimpse into the authentic Vadodara experience.
